We’ve seen Will.I.Am change career directions from a recording artist to an ‘entrepreneur’ and now he claims that he’s launching a new car company. Sadly the car isn’t that original.

The car in the photo above is the first product of his venture I.Am.Auto and he claims that it’s made from mostly Chrysler parts. It may look cool to some, especially if you were around in the eighties or more specifically if you watched Back to the Future as a kid.

Why? Because it looks just like a DeLorean with a crappy looking body kit and 24” rims according to Jalopnik. So why is Will.I.Am saying this car is his creation? God only knows.

If you took this beast up to 88mph… parts would start to fall off.

The Black Eyed Peas star went on ‘The Tonight Show with Jay Leno’ on Wednesday to explain his dream of becoming the next Henry Ford.

“I’m a big technology freak and geek and I invested my money in building my own vehicle because I want to bring jobs to the ghetto that I come from, so why not invest?

“Like I invested in making a demo to start the Black Eyed Peas, we did that, now I want to invest to have a car company in the neighbourhood that I come from.”

He then went on to tell Jay what the car is made from. However, it doesn’t really make sense.

“I went to Chrysler and got a whole bunch of parts to where it’s still certified as a legal vehicle on the streets. So I don’t really mess with the airbag configurations or things like that. Kept the chassis and we create the shell, which is the body and the interior and the audio interface… it’s sick, it’s really fresh.”

That’s all well and good if only one eagle-eyed fan of the DMC didn’t spot a similar looking car in the background of an episode of the TV show West Coast Customs (like Pimp My Ride, but without Xzibit).
